]> git.donarmstrong.com Git - debbugs.git/blobdiff - cgi/pkgindex.cgi
handle the maintainer being undef properly
[debbugs.git] / cgi / pkgindex.cgi
index 06154d5c6e9f15aa25cd00200b0fba119a537d7f..21acad5344d6425ff4ba901665fc8ab6dfafe71f 100755 (executable)
@@ -87,7 +87,7 @@ if ($indexon eq "pkg") {
     $htmldescrip{$pkg} = sprintf('<a href="%s">%s</a> (%s)',
                            package_links(package => $pkg, links_only=>1),
                            html_escape($pkg),
-                                package_links(maint=>$maintainers{$pkg}));
+                                package_links(maint=>$maintainers{$pkg}//[]));
   }
 } elsif ($indexon eq "src") {
   $tag = "source package";
@@ -115,7 +115,7 @@ if ($indexon eq "pkg") {
     $htmldescrip{$src} = sprintf('<a href="%s">%s</a> (%s)',
                            package_links(src => $src, links_only=>1),
                            html_escape($src),
-                                package_links(maint => $maintainers{$src}));
+                                package_links(maint => $maintainers{$src}//[]));
   }
 } elsif ($indexon eq "maint") {
   $tag = "maintainer";